About Crédit Agricole Corporate and Investment Bank (Crédit Agricole CIB)

Crédit Agricole CIB is the corporate and investment banking arm of Crédit Agricole Group, the 10th largest banking group worldwide in terms of balance sheet size (The Banker, July 2022).
8,600 employees in more than 30 countries across Europe, the Americas, Asia-Pacific, the Middle-East and North Africa, support the Bank's clients, meeting their financial needs throughout the world.
Crédit Agricole CIB offers its large corporate and institutional clients a range of products and services in capital market activities, investment banking, structured finance, commercial banking and international trade.
The Bank is a pioneer in the area of climate finance, and is currently a market leader in this segment with a complete offer for all its clients.

Capital Market IT (CMI) oversees the information systems for Global Markets Division (and affiliated partner support functions) covering all capital markets domains (from pre-trade to post trade through risk management and regulatory reporting). CMI covers all IT activities, ensuring applicative support to end-users, maintenance and evolution of the information system including ambitious and innovative transformation programs to accompany business growth. Capital Market IT teams are distributed across the world, currently in Paris, London, Hong Kong, Singapore and New York.

Capital Market IT is looking to reinforce its presence in the Americas, consolidating and reinforcing its Run and Build teams with ambitions to support Americas business growth.

As such, CACIB Americas IT is hiring its Head of Americas Capital Market IT in New York who will be responsible for putting in place a resilient and sustainable setup to support Capital Market information system for the Americas with CMI global support.
